Where in Asian can a guy go to a nudist beach?
 In Japan, there are only two places where guys (mostly gay men) go as a nude beach (one in Chiba, and the other is a deserted spot on Shonan Beach). Neither are well known by the general public partly because they are so hard to find, and far from Tokyo. Also, it's not like Black's Beach or ones in other Westernized countries, people get naked very discreetly even on a supposedly nude beach. They generally wear swimwear when walking around or when in the water, but remove their clothes while lying in the sun.
The next best thing to a nude beach then is a hot springs resort or a public bathing spa, the latter of which there are over 50 in Tokyo. In these, men and women have separate bathing areas. 
Often, there is a small outside areas (enclosed by a fence for privacy) where the naked men can soak in a pool of mineral waters or lounge naked or draped in a towel. Inside, there are various types of baths, but the men are usually totally naked when walking to and from each pool and when they sit on stools at individual showers for washing body and hair. Many of them have wet and dry saunas. So, despite their being little interest in nude beaches, Japanese are often fond of such warm mineral baths, and even travel to stay in the many areas of the country where there are nice resort hotels grouped around these hot springs, such as Hakone.

However, you don't have to go far from any metropolitan area to enjoy the same atmosphere of men enjoying being naked. Formerly, there were the old-fashioned public baths or 'sento' in every neighorhood, which have just about disappeared these days, being replaced by large, more modern and luxurious: bathing resort (or 'onsen' - hot springs bath or spa). The water has a higher content of minerals, particularly sodium (salt) and it's either brought in or created, but in sometimes comes naturally from the ground as Japan is a set of volcanic islands, also prone to earthquakes, as everyone knows.

Diamond Head Beach (Lighthouse Beach)
For nudism, the closest place to Waikiki where you can go to a gay and sometimes discreetly nude beach on Oahu is at Diamond Head Beach (below the Light House). It can be cruisy, but you need to be aware that it is part of a public beach and not everybody walking down along the shore is a guy looking for gay sex. Tourists, people walking their pets, and families sometimes walk thru and even stop to enjoy the beach too. However, it does get cruisy at times -- sometimes best when the sun has started to set or after sunset. Just be discreet and cover up if somebody who looks like a cop comes thru. I have never seen a police office or been stopped myself, but I've "heard" that arrests have been made for public indecency. I have received a parking ticket - so don't park where it is prohibited or after posted hours. There are places to "hide", ledges to sunbathe nude without being seen from below and I've had some wild times there both in broad daylight and after dusk, especially on the forested hillside just above this beach.

How to get there..
From the east end of Waikiki, you can drive there or it is even possible to walk (20-30 minute walk across and down along Kapiolani Park) to its eastern end and then walk up about 700 yards to the drive way that goes down to Light House Beach. You can't miss Diamond Head crater's peak looming overhead -- which can be seen from anywhere in Honolulu. If you drive, then you can follow Kalakaua east to the Zoo and then continue due east along Kapiolani Park to its end and then turn right on Diamond Head road. There is a small road down the beach -- but there is limited parking there (don't leave a car at most Diamond Head Road street parking after 10pm or as posted!!)

If driving, it is easier sometimes to go on passed the light house and then look for parking up at the look-out point(s) along Diamond Head Road (regular unmetered parking) or for roadside parking on the mountain side of Diamond Head Road. As any place in Honolulu - don't leave valuables in your car and don't park where people can easily sneak up and open your car -- car break-ins in Honolulu  are among the highest rates in the entire country -- more than New York City, by far. So you'd best take precautions.

If you're really worried about break-ins,  then drive your rental car,  but park instead at Kapiolani Park,  or take a bus (#14) or a taxi and then walk back from the nearest bus stop to beach, or just walk all the way from Waikiki and back - which is what I usually do., besides, it's good exercise too. The walk through Kapiolani Park either way is beautiful. Nudism on beaches in Spain is very much alive and well, and hardly confined to the recreational pursuits of gay men. There is a wide audience across the nation for naturism (FKK) beaches. 


Of course, where you find a nude beach, you may also find men who are out and about cruising for anonymous sex. It's simply what comes with the territory -- so to speak. 


Like has been mentioned above, there are clothing optional beaches all over Spain. Sometimes, they are just outside (a kilometer or 2 beyond) the famous textile (bathing suits required) beaches. 


For example, near Gandia, south of Valencia, is a pristine white sand beach. But just up coast about 800 m is the clothing optional section (a bit further and behind that is the so-called 'gay beach'). I suspect that a similar layout falls many of the seaside beaches throughout Spain and it is also more or less similar in many other European nations, particularly where the beautiful sea is bathed in warm sunshine, such as Portugal, Italy, Southern France, Croatia, etc (and in some cooler climates as well, The Netherlands and Northern Germany, Norway and Sweden, too.) Even Austria and Czech Republic have their 'baden' where men and women bath and lie out naked to sun themselves at communal baths (although very far from any ocean). 


My personal favorite one is Spain is Maspolamas and Playa del Ingles on the southern end of Gran Canaria (one of the Canary Islands). It's also a popular gay resort destination too (in the cooler months of the year Nov- April). In the summer, Gran Canaria is a (fairly) cheap beach vacation for many middle-class families from Europe so there are few gay vacations at that time. I say 'fairly cheap' because I spent far less to travel there and stay than many of the UK/Northern Europe visitors seemed to do. After leaving GC, I visited London. I couldn't believe the prices in British pounds that were being asked for a full travel package to GC (or other Canary Island resorts).


You can make out much cheaper by buying each piece separately: flights (on a discounted carrier), hotel or apartment accommodation with a kitchen, then cook yourselves and eat out cheaply). There is ample bus transportation around the island and back and forth to the airport (LPA) - without getting one of the very pricey tour packages that includes so-called 4-5 star accommodations and a full board meal plan. 
Such price restrictions also put a limit on what you can do while you are on the island since meal service is planned for certain limited times. The Yumbo Centre only gets really going for gay night life until after 10pm at night. Thus making breakfast from 7:30-9am a bummer for most gay singles and couples who visit the island.
